Literature summary for 3.4.24.63 extracted from

  • Ongeri, E.M.; Anyanwu, O.; Reeves, W.B.; Bond, J.S.
    Villin and actin in the mouse kidney brush-border membrane bind to and are degraded by meprins, an interaction that contributes to injury in ischemia-reperfusion (2011), Am. J. Physiol. Renal Physiol., 301, F871-F882.

General Information

General Information Comment Organism
malfunction following ischemia-reperfusion, meprins and villin redistribute from the brush-border membranes to the cytosol. A 37-kDa actin fragment is detected in protein fractions from wild-type, but not in comparable preparations from meprin knockout mice Rattus norvegicus
